In 2019-2020, 2,331 people earned their degree in wildlife, fish and wildlands science and management, making the major the 267th most popular in the United States.

Across Idaho, there were 57 wildlife, fish and wildlands science and management gra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 57 wildlife, fish and wildlands science and management gra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,211 and $23,934 respectively.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Brigham Young University - Idaho.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Wildlife, Fish and Wildlands Science and Management Schools for a Bachelor’s in Idaho For Those Getting Aid list. Located in Rexburg, Idaho, this large private not-for-profit school handed out 22 diplomas to qualified bachelors’s wildlife, fish and wildlands science and management students in 2019-2020.

BYU - I also took the #2 spot in our “Best Wildlife, Fish & Wildl&s Science & Management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Idaho” ranking. The yearly cost to attend BYU - I is $7,167 for idaho bachelor’s degree wildlife, fish and wildlands science and management students with aid.

The student loan default rate at the school is 3.2%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.

University of Idaho

Moscow, Idaho
#1 in overall quality

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Idaho. The school came in at #2 for the Best Value Wildlife, Fish and Wildlands Science and Management Schools for a Bachelor’s in Idaho For Those Getting Aid. U of I is a public institution located in Moscow, Idaho. The school has a fairly large population, and it awarded 35 bachelors’s degrees in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at U of I, the school also landed the #1 spot in our “Best Wildlife, Fish & Wildl&s Science & Management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Idaho”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for U of I is $14,132 for idaho bachelor’s degree wildlife, fish and wildlands science and management students with aid.
